Your duties include:
- Install, commission, and maintain Syntegon Secondary Packaging equipment, including final mechanical positioning, levelling, running equipment to agreed specifications and ultimately perform site acceptance tests.
- Travel globally (approximately 80% of the time, including both national and international assignments), with flexibility for short-notice travel and occasional weekend work.
- Carry out routine maintenance and planned servicing according to service agreements and schedules.
- Troubleshoot and resolve electrical, mechanical, and software issues, identifying root causes and liaising with engineering teams when necessary.
- Provide customer training on equipment operation and routine maintenance, managing customer expectations and advising on future Maintenance Programmes.
- Respond to breakdowns and short-notice call-outs, working to tight timescales to minimise downtime.
- Produce detailed reports following site visits and submit relevant expenses in a timely manner.
- Support product trials and identify opportunities for machine upgrades and modernisation.
- Maintain up-to-date product knowledge through ongoing training.
- Support the manufacturing facility in Bristol when required.
Your profile should include the following knowledge and skills:
- Qualifications in Mechatronics, mechanical or electrical engineering.
- Electrical engineering β a good understanding of both modern and older control systems across a wide range of platforms.
- Ability to work under own initiative.
- Understanding correct methods of mechanical fitting from changing bearings to setting up machinery.
- Adjusting high speed packaging machinery to achieve optimum efficiency.
- Ability to find and identify worn and damaged parts from assembly drawings.
- PLC theory and practice.
- Ability to fault find within our software, Allen Bradley preferred but Beckhoff and Siemens advantageous.
- Commercial awareness, being able to spot opportunities such as machine upgrades and modernization.
- An understanding of high level of customer service.
- Ability to prioritise work to challenging deadlines.
- Good communication skills.
- Ability to work remotely, often overseas in a variety of locations in different time zones.
- Full driving license.
- Experience in a previous field service role is desirable.
- Exposure to FMCG manufacturing industry β food and packaging would be an advantage.
- Packaging engineering and technical skills desirable.
